4. Carbon Window Tint. Carbon window tint is known for its excellent heat rejection capabilities and color stability. It contains carbon particles that help block heat and reduce glare while maintaining a stylish appearance. Carbon tint also tends to be non-reflective, making it suitable for GPS and radio signal-friendly installations.

Carbon window tint film — the darkest tint ever. The carbon film contains tiny carbon particles that darken the glass and repel sunlight very effectively. It looks darker than other types of films. Therefore, for hot and sunny states, a carbon tint becomes a very good choice.

Carbon tints are generally more affordable than ceramic tints, making them an attractive option for car owners working with a tight budget. However, if viewed as an investment rather than an expense, the higher cost of the ceramic tint pays off in the longer run with the high degree of protection and durability it offers.

According to market reports and analysis, the average Carbon window tint is between 20 and 25 percent lesser than Ceramic tint. For instance, if a Carbon tint costs on average about $200, a Ceramic tint may cost between $240 and $250 on average.
